Did you know that there is a gaming console that actually caters to Steam games? These are called Steam Machines, which runs either in Linux or Windows operating systems that boot directly into Steam. The CyberPowerPC Syber Gaming Vapor A is one of these machines, which I will review for today’s article.

The Syber Gaming Vapor A is based on an AMD Athlon x4 processor and is the lowest priced model in the group at $595. Its quad-core processor is paired with a Radeon R9 270 GPU video card, which provides gamers with high frame rates at high-quality settings.

The Vapor A is available in either black or white console-style case and is larger than a PlayStation 3. Its case, though, provides several open vents to provide superb cooling. This keeps the system running silently, even after several hours of playing.

The Vapor A comes with a Logitech game controller and a Syber mini keyboard controller along with the system console. Its accessories include a charging cable for the Logitech controller, two USB dongles, two antennas for Wi-Fi or Bluetooth, and a USB receiver extension cable.

You can find the power button, a single USB 2.0 port, and a dual USB 3.0 port in the system front panel. It also has front connections for headphones and microphones.

The back panel of the system, on the other hand, looks similar to a traditional PC. Its motherboard connectors allow you to connect to Wi-Fi antennas and six additional USB devices, including two USB 3.0 and four USB 2.0. It also has additional audio connectors.

Although it is the lowest priced model in its group, the Syber Gaming Vapor A will run high-resolution games at medium to high settings. Performance-wise, this system console will allow you to run your favorite games at 1080 pixels resolution all day long. This system provides a winning solution for gamers who want to use a different system to play their Steam games aside from their gaming PC.
